      Question WBTB Alarm

      So, lets say you used to wake up in the middle of the night naturally, but now you don't, at least as often. Now you can't do the DEILD'S that seemed so promising. So, you decide to set an alarm 2.5 and 4.5 hours after you go to sleep. (2.5 hours later) the alarm goes off, however, it keeps on ringing, forcing you to stop it, and making you forget your dream, goodbye DEILD. You get out of bed grumpy, and get on DV, then you create a thread and ask if anyone knows of an app that has an alarm that rings once or twice and then turns of automatically so this doesn't happen again, and they say...

      i wanted to answer here much earlier...
      the time i experiment with it was also alarm clock plus... worked like a charme after two days i knew how loud and long the alarm had to be to wake up from it.

      but i really only can emphasis that i would work with your natural waking. its way way better for recall because an alarm always rips you of the dream. i would work with a mantra like "i notice every wakening i have and remember my dreams" tell you something like this before you fall asleep and it will work after some days. when i work on this i notice between 3 and 5 wakenings each night... with recall of the previous dream and then you can decide if you want to lay still and do deild or to do a short or a long wbtb or whatever.
      but in my opinion this is a way more naturally approach to this. and after some time it is second nature and you will notice how you lay around middle of the night and thinking about your last dream before you even notice that you are awake
